NATIVE AMERICAN DESIGNATION ON LICENSES

Passed One ChamberFiled Jan 30, 2026
Sponsor: Abeyta, Michelle Paulene
Latest Action

action postponed indefinitely

Mar 24, 2026

Summary

The bill changes licensing rules so the Motor Vehicle Division must allow a distinguishing mark on driver’s licenses and identification cards that indicates the holder is Native American, without naming a specific tribe. Applicants must submit an enhanced tribal card, tribal ID, tribal blood certificate, or a tribal/BIA affidavit to qualify. The measure also adds donor‑status fields to the forms and creates a statewide donor registry.
